Top shoes 2025 trends to watch
1. Sustainable and recycled materials
Vegan leathers, recycled rubber, and regenerated nylon are becoming mainstream. Brands that once focused solely on aesthetics now advertise carbon footprints and transparent supply chains. Look for shoes labeled with recycled content or low-energy manufacturing processes.
2. Smart and adaptive footwear
Expect more adaptive fit technologies—think memory-foam linings, adjustable lacing systems, and even basic smart-insoles that monitor step count. These practical upgrades make daily comfort non-negotiable.
3. Hybrid silhouettes: dress + sport
The line between dress shoes and sneakers continues to blur. Leather sneakers with molded soles, minimal derby-sneaker hybrids, and lightweight-chunky loafers are perfect for the modern office and after-hours drinks.
4. Chunky soles and elevated platforms
The chunky sole trend persists, but it’s more refined in 2025—clean lines, sculpted midsoles, and monochrome palettes that add height without feeling clunky.
How to pick the right pair: practical style tips
Buying shoes isn’t just about chasing trends. Here are actionable tips to make smarter choices.
Know your lifestyle
Do you commute, travel, or work from home? If you commute, prioritize durable outsoles and water resistance. Travelers benefit from lightweight, packable options. If your day is office-heavy, invest in one classic dress shoe and one versatile sneaker.
Build a balanced rotation
Aim for five reliable pairs: a clean white sneaker, a leather derby, a casual suede loafer, a sturdy boot, and a performance trainer. This capsule ensures you have footwear for formal occasions, casual weekends, and active days.
Fit and comfort over brand hype
Comfort equals confidence. Always try shoes on later in the day when your feet are a bit swollen to get a real sense of fit. Look for proper arch support, roomy toe boxes, and secure heels. If you’re unsure, consider visiting a specialist store for a gait analysis.
Outfit combinations that work right now
Here are simple, tested combos that will keep you looking modern without trying too hard.
Weekend casual
White minimalist sneakers + slim dark denim + a neutral crewneck sweater. Add a lightweight bomber for cooler days. This is the safe, stylish baseline for 2025.
Smart-casual office
Leather derby-sneaker hybrid + tapered chinos + a button-down shirt. Swap the shirt for a fine-gauge knit in colder months. This look moves seamlessly from meetings to after-work drinks.
Layered city outfit
Chunky-soled boots + cropped wool trousers + textured overcoat. Use accessories like a leather belt and minimal watch to pull it together.

Care and maintenance: keep them looking new
Proper care extends the life of any pair. Rotate your shoes, use cedar shoe trees for leather, clean suede with an appropriate brush, and apply waterproofing sprays for rain-prone seasons. For deeper maintenance advice, see our Shoe Care Guide.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. What are the most popular men’s shoes in 2025?
Popular categories include sustainable sneakers, hybrid dress-sneaker models, minimal leather sneakers, and refined chunky-soled boots. Comfort-driven designs and eco-conscious materials dominate.
2. How should I style chunky-soled shoes without looking bulky?
Balance proportions: pair chunky soles with slimmer trousers or cropped hems to show a clean break at the ankle. Keep the rest of the outfit streamlined and neutral to avoid visual clutter.
3. Are sustainable shoes worth the extra cost?
Generally yes—sustainable footwear often uses durable materials and ethical manufacturing, which can mean longer lifespans and fewer replacements. If budget is a concern, look for brands that mix recycled content with classic construction.
